What is it?

The Neo G Ankle Brace is a structured yet flexible ankle brace made from durable, heat therapeutic neoprene. It is designed to help stabilise the ankle joint by limiting excessive plantarflexion (downward pointing of the foot), inversion (rolling outward) and eversion (rolling inward). These movements are commonly associated with ligamentous injuries and ankle instability.

The bracing support wraps securely around the ankle and uses adjustable fastening to provide a controlled, supportive fit. The neoprene material helps retain natural body heat, creating a warming effect around the joint and surrounding soft tissues.

This product is registered as a CE marked Class I Medical Device and is suitable for everyday use when extra ankle stability is required.

How does the brace work?

The support brace works through a combination of compression, controlled restriction, and thermal support.

Compression: The snug fit helps provide proprioceptive feedback, increasing awareness of ankle position and encouraging more controlled movement.

Movement limitation: The structure of the brace helps reduce excessive plantarflexion, inversion, and eversion — movements commonly linked to ligament strain.

Heat therapy: The neoprene material retains natural body heat. This warming effect may help increase circulation to the area, easing stiffness and supporting joint mobility.

Together, these elements provide practical support for everyday function and gradual return to activity.

Fit & comfort check

The support should feel comfortable, not painful. It must not cause numbness, tingling, or skin irritation.

Adjust the straps so that the ankle feels supported but circulation is not restricted. If your foot becomes cold, discoloured, or uncomfortable, loosen or remove the support.

Always wear over clean, dry skin. If wearing inside footwear, ensure shoes provide enough room to accommodate the brace comfortably.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Over-tightening the straps in an attempt to create rigid immobilisation
  • Wearing the support continuously without giving the skin time to breathe
  • Using it as a substitute for medical assessment in severe injuries
  • Wearing inside footwear that is too tight, causing unnecessary pressure
